For hiring teams looking to attract talent on TikTok, choosing the right hashtags is as critical as crafting the job post itself. According to a recent report from Onrec, the TikTok Creative Center stands out as the best starting point for identifying region- and industry-specific tags. The platform offers valuable insights into tag performance, including trend movement, related hashtags, and audience demographics—all available at no cost.
Recruiters are advised to treat hashtags like search terms when building outreach strategies. By aligning tags with the language and interests of target candidates, hiring teams can increase visibility in relevant feeds and communities. The Creative Center’s data-driven approach allows users to refine their tag selection based on real-time trends and audience splits, improving the precision of recruitment campaigns.
This method supports a more strategic use of TikTok’s algorithm, helping content reach users who are not only engaged but also likely to match desired candidate profiles. Since the platform is free to access, it lowers the barrier for teams of all sizes to implement data-informed hashtag strategies without investing in premium analytics tools.
